Just over a year ago on January 30th 2013, Ghanaian actress Nana Ama McBrown and partner Maxwell Mensah were involved in a car accident which nearly claimed her life.
Since surviving the accident Nana has never failed to appreciate the gift of life, taking on many charitable projects over the past year. As the one year anniversary of what could have been a fatal crash came around the gorgeous actress decided to make some charitable donations to the Teshie Orphanage accompanied by her family and partner.
Speaking at after the donation Nana Ama said , “I thank God for our lives. God is indeed wonderful and a merciful God. Exactly a year by this time I was in a sick bed fight for my life and today, I am here alive strong and kicking. All I can say is thank you God for giving a second chance”.
The actress also thanked the nurses and doctors at the Yaa Asantewaa wards at the 37 Military hospital, her family, and her fans for supporting her all through a very difficult period of her life.
